exosome

/ˈɛks.oʊˌsoʊm/
noun 2

Definitions

noun

1

An intracellular macromolecular protein complex involved in RNA degradation.

2

An extracellular vesicle released from the endosomal compartment of eukaryotic cells, responsible for the selective removal of plasma membrane protein.
